Despite its modest nature, Mossley Hill does well to accommodate the needs of its passengers. It offers convenient ticket purchasing options, including a ticket office with opening hours from Monday to Saturday, 5:50 AM to 11:45 PM and Sunday, 8:30 AM to 11:15 PM. There are ticket machines available for collecting pre-booked tickets, albeit not specifically designed for accessibility. If you need assistance with your journey, staff can be found at the station during their working hours, or you might also consider using the helpline at 08002006060.
For accessibility, the station provides step-free access and seating areas. While there are no waiting rooms, the seating areas offer a place to rest amidst your travels. Keep in mind, however, that facilities such as accessible toilets, refreshment kiosks, and ATMs are not available here, nor are there any retail or exchange services. Cyclists can find storage for up to 8 bicycles within the station car park, though the storage area isn't sheltered.

The station is well-equipped to handle the needs of modern travelers. With a ticket office open throughout the week and ticket machines available at multiple locations including accessible ones at the station's entrance, purchasing tickets is both easy and efficient. Your smartcards can also be obtained and validated here, making your journey smoother. For those in need of assistance, help points are readily available, and customer service staff are on hand to provide support. Though there isn't luggage storage, there is comprehensive CCTV coverage to ensure security.
Swindon Station is a Category A station, offering step-free access across all platforms via a subway and lifts. Accessibility is prioritized with features such as ramps for train access, wheelchair availability, and accessible car park equipment. Car parking is ample with 591 spaces available 24/7, including eight designated accessible spaces. Despite the station's excellent facilities, there are no accessible toilets or a first-class lounge, but there's a baby changing area at Platform 4.
